A槽-type liquid distributor is a high-performance liquid distributor, used in the feed section of a packed tower. It boasts easy installation, uniform liquid distribution, high density of spray points, and low pressure drop, and is currently widely applied.

Channel liquid distributors are typically composed of a distributing channel (also known as the main channel or primary channel) and a distribution channel (also referred to as the secondary channel or sub-channel). The primary channel initially divides the liquid into several streams through openings at the bottom, distributing them to the lower liquid distribution channels. The bottom (or walls) of the distribution channels are equipped with holes (or conduits) to evenly distribute the liquid over the packing layer. Channel liquid distributors offer high operational flexibility and excellent anti-plugging properties, particularly suitable for separating high gas-liquid loads and liquids containing solid suspended particles, high viscosity, and are widely used. Their excellent distribution and anti-plugging capabilities make them highly applicable.

Trough Liquid Distributor Performance Features
The function of the liquid distributor is to uniformly distribute or redistribute the liquid at the top of the packing or at a certain height, thereby increasing the effective surface for mass and heat transfer, enhancing inter-phase contact, and ultimately improving the efficiency of the tower.
Laboratory tests have proven that the fluid flow within the packed bed is not uniform plug flow, but rather exhibits沟流(gutter flow),偏流(shear flow), and壁流(wall flow) phenomena. This leads to amplification and end effects in the packed tower. The purpose of reasonably designing and selecting liquid initial distributors and redistributors is to minimize and prevent these amplification effects in the packed tower, thereby reducing tower height and diameter, and lowering construction or operational costs.

Poor distribution of liquid within the packing tower is categorized into large-scale and small-scale issues. Small-scale poor distribution is caused by liquid channeling within the packing layer, while large-scale poor distribution is attributed to the liquid distributor, leading to a significant decrease in the tower's efficiency. Tests show that the higher the packing efficiency, the greater the impact of liquid distribution quality on packing performance. For instance, when the liquid distribution quality reaches 50%, the theoretical number of plates per meter of packing, for a packing with a theoretical number of plates equal to 20, is only 11.5, and for packing with a theoretical number of plates equal to 8, it is only 5.5.
